基於ReactNative和Realm的開源專案
相信大家在學習ReactNative中,都瞭解知乎日報這個完全基於RN做的開源專案,因為知乎的網路請求API都開源,所以做這個知乎日報的專案是再合適不過了。
基於新聞板塊,我又添加了一個日記的功能,做了本地儲存,RN中做本地儲存非常牛逼的控制元件就是Realm,所以James這個開源專案也用了Realm這個控制元件,並且都添加了Realm的增刪改查功能。
程式碼比較簡單易懂,有興趣學習RN和Realm的童鞋可以看一下這個開源專案。
https://github.com/LonerJimmy/James
專案中包括了RN中TabNavigator,ScrollableTabView,Navigator,TextInput等元件的使用,初學者可以通過看這個專案中的原始碼來學習RN,我相信是非常有用的。
專案執行效果圖:
相關推薦
基於ReactNative和Realm的開源專案
相信大家在學習ReactNative中,都瞭解知乎日報這個完全基於RN做的開源專案,因為知乎的網路請求API都開源,所以做這個知乎日報的專案是再合適不過了。 基於新聞板塊,我又添加了一個日記的功能,做了本地儲存,RN中做本地儲存非常牛逼的控制元件就是Realm
vue 外掛庫和一些開源專案
Vue2.0 一些常用外掛庫 UI元件 開發框架 實用庫 服務端 nuxt.js - 用於伺服器渲染Vue app的最小化框架 express-vue - 簡單的使用伺服器端渲染vue.js vue-ssr - 非常簡單的VueJS伺服器端渲
基於bootstrap和php的專案
這幾天在做專案,前端頁面用bootstrap搭建,簡直快到無與倫比。動態頁面用php顯示,簡單來說就是從資料庫動態的讀取,再以列表的形式顯示部分資料,點進去能看到這個資料的詳細資訊。類似於從百度搜索問題->瀏覽搜尋結果->點進去檢視詳情,這樣一種套路。 資料是大
原始碼提供!Android即時通訊和sns開源專案彙總
這是一個整理即時通訊(IM)和社交系統(SNS)優秀開源專案的文件,專案上傳github歡迎提交更新。 一 國內即時通訊和社交系統平臺 排名不分先後! 2 環信 3 網易雲信 5 騰訊雲 6 融雲 二 基於LeanCloud的開源專案 三 基於環信的即時通訊開源專案 資料整理
【開源專案系列】如何基於 Spring Cache 實現多級快取(同時整合本地快取 Ehcache 和分散式快取 Redis)
## 一、快取 當系統的併發量上來了,如果我們頻繁地去訪問資料庫,那麼會使資料庫的壓力不斷增大,在高峰時甚至可以出現數據庫崩潰的現象。所以一般我們會使用快取來解決這個資料庫併發訪問問題,使用者訪問進來,會先從快取裡查詢,如果存在則返回,如果不存在再從資料庫裡查詢,最後新增到快取裡,然後返回給使用者,當然了,接
「免費開源」基於Vue和Quasar的前端SPA專案crudapi後臺管理系統實戰之自定義元件(四)
# 基於Vue和Quasar的前端SPA專案實戰之序列號(四) ## 回顧 通過上一篇文章 [基於Vue和Quasar的前端SPA專案實戰之佈局選單(三)](https://www.cnblogs.com/crudapi/p/14536313.html)的介紹,我們已經完成了佈局選單,本文主要介紹序列號功能
wangEditor-基於javascript和css開發的 Web富文本編輯器, 輕量、簡潔、易用、開源免費(2)
配置 格式 報錯 編輯 無需 設置 rev 限制 lang 1 <!DOCTYPE html> 2 <html lang="en"> 3 4 <head> 5 <meta charset="
基於spring和mybatis專案的JUnit測試用例的實現
主要目的:實現JUnit的Crud 專案目前情況:spring+mybatis 想在前後端分離的情況下, 後端實現各個模組CRUD的junit 遇到的最大問題先是注入之後提示nullPointException 接著很快反應過來 是junit執行單個檔案的時候並沒有在啟動容器
我的mqtt協議和emqttd開源專案個人理解(25) - 協議裡面Clean Session為0和1的區別
一、基本概念 Session 會話 定義 定義:某個客戶端(由ClientID作為標識)和某個伺服器之間的邏輯層面的通訊 生命週期(存在時間):會話 >= 網路連線 CleanSession 標記 在Connect時,由客戶端設定 0 —
你想要的全平臺全棧開源專案 - Vue、React、小程式、Android原生、ReactNative、java後端
全平臺全棧開源專案 coderiver 今天終於開始前後端聯調了~ 首先感謝大家的支援,coderiver 在 GitHub 上開源兩週,獲得了 54 個 Star,9 個 Fork,5 個 Watch。 這些鼓勵和認可也更加堅定了我繼續寫下去的決心~ 再次感謝各位大佬! 專案地址: github.co
【機器人學】機器人開源專案KDL原始碼學習:(3)機器人操作空間路徑規劃(Path Planning)和軌跡規劃(Trajectory Planning)示例
很多同學會把路徑規劃(Path Planning)和軌跡規劃(Trajectory Planning)這兩個概念混淆,路徑規劃只是表示了機械臂末端在操作空間中的幾何資訊,比如從工作臺的一端(A點)沿直線移動到另一端(B點)。而軌跡規劃則加上了時間律,比如它要完成的任務是從A點開始到B點結束,中間
基於Mint UI開發VUE專案一之環境搭建和頭部底部導航欄的實現
一:簡介 Mint UI 包含豐富的 CSS 和 JS 元件,能夠滿足日常的移動端開發需要。通過它,可以快速構建出風格統一的頁面,提升開發效率。真正意義上的按需載入元件。可以只加載宣告過的元件及其樣式檔案,無需再糾結檔案體積過大。考慮到移動端的效能門檻,Mint UI 採用 CSS3 處理各種動效,避免瀏覽
Java 基於zxing開源專案生成二維碼以及二維碼解析譯碼
基於zxing3.3.3,點選進行跳轉到github的zxing開源專案下載開源專案檔案 JDK版本為1.8 zxing-3.3.3 jar包下載 注意: 1、二維碼掃描出來的網址顯示的是文字而不是連結網站的原因:沒有在網址前面加http://或https:// 例如:將ww
opencv 視覺專案學習筆記(二): 基於 svm 和 knn 車牌識別
車牌識別的屬於常見的 模式識別 ,其基本流程為下面三個步驟: 1) 分割: 檢測並檢測影象中感興趣區域; 2)特徵提取: 對字元影象集中的每個部分進行提取; 3)分類: 判斷影象快是不是車牌或者 每個車牌字元的分類。 車牌識別分為兩個步驟, 車牌檢測, 車牌識別, 都屬於模式識別。 基本結構如下: 一、車牌
兩大開源專案更新發布:Fedora29Beta和Java11
Fedroa 29Beta Fedora 專案宣佈釋出 Fedora 29 Beta。Fedora 29 採用 GNOME 3.30 桌面環境,Fedora Atomic Workstation 重新命名為 Fedora Silverblue,單系統安裝將隱藏 GRUB 選
Android Hawk資料庫的原始碼解析,Github開源專案,基於SharedPreferences的的儲存框架
今天看了朋友一個專案用到了Hawk,然後寫了這邊文章 一、瞭解一下概念 Android Hawk資料庫github開源專案 Hawk是一個非常便捷的資料庫.操作資料庫只需一行程式碼,能存任何資料型別. 相信大家應該很熟悉SharedPreferences。它是一種輕量級的儲存簡單配置
基於RBAC模型的許可權系統設計(Github開源專案)
計劃在Team的Github開源專案里加入許可權控制的業務功能。從而實現許可權控制。在很多管理系統裡都是有許可權管理這些通用模組的,當然在企業專案裡,許可權控制是很繁雜的。 Team的Github開源
學習網站專案學習 - 基於Django 和 Vue的前後端資料互動
目錄 一、前後端互動實現思路 1-1 前端思路 1-2 後端思路 二、前端設計 2-1 預設資料設定 2-1-1 建立檢視元件 DataTest.vue 2-1-2 router.js 路由配置 2-1-3 App.vue配置 2-2 使用axios獲取資料
基於開源專案OpenCV的人臉識別Demo版整理(不僅可以識別人臉,還可以識別眼睛鼻子嘴等)
最近對人臉識別的程式非常感興趣,但是苦於沒有選修多媒體方向,看了幾篇關於人臉識別的論文,大概也沒看懂多少,什麼灰度處理啊,切割識別啊,雲裡霧裡,傻傻看不明白啊。各種苦惱。 於是就在網上找找,看有木有神馬開原始碼啊,要是有個現成的原始碼就更好了,百度it ,那些
基於spark和flink的電商資料分析專案
目錄 業務需求 業務資料來源 使用者訪問Session分析 Session聚合統計 Session分層抽樣 Top10熱門品類 Top10活躍Session 頁面單跳轉化率分析 各區域熱門商品統計分析 廣告點選流量實時統計分析